I had this experiece with Nitro RC: Purchased their standoff scale ARF of BURT RUTAN'S LONG EZ for $123 including shipping, which I consider a good price. The "instructions" are less than useless for a newbie, but who needs 'em? [img][/img]and there were several areas of assembly that needed some "re-design." Some of the supplied hardware was junk and had to be replaced. I'm an experienced builder so I got'er done. But I did a lot of talkin' to myself..which I'm not allowed to post on RCU!!!!! Final word: If it flies as good as it looks, this ARF is worth the price.
